Job summary

Ethos Veterinary Health is seeking a full-time Emergency Veterinarian in Concord, CA to deliver high-quality emergency and critical care to a diverse caseload of companion animals. The role features a 12-shift/month schedule with 10-hour shifts and a compensation package that offers $200,000 plus production and incentives.

You will join a newer, state-of-the-art facility with a collaborative team of veterinarians and specialists dedicated to compassionate care and professional growth.

The Concord Difference


  • Newer state-of-the-art facility built in 2022

    • We designed our new, 27,000 square foot hospital with collaboration in mind. Just a few of the features of the hospital include:

      • Fear Free principals used throughout

      • A dedicated cat-only ward in the ICU

      • Four banks of oxygen cages

      • Three ultrasound rooms

      • Six operating rooms





  • Ultrasound support 7 days a week for the ER

  • ER team is supported by a positive and approachable team of specialists including on‑call Surgeons

  • We have a full-time Criticalist to support our 24/7 hospital

  • Dedicated ER and CCU nurses which allows for effective workflow and continuity of care for patients
